Prevalence of urinary iodine concentration among school children: in Dessie City, Ethiopia
Abstract Background Urinary iodine is recommended by the world health organization as the main indicator to assess iodine status in a population. Despite this recommendation little is known about urinary iodine concentration in the study area. Therefore, this study aimed to determine the level of ur...
